Publicidad
Publicidad

Más contenido relacionado

Publicidad
Publicidad

Trabajo de desarrollo en entornos case

  1. CUESTIONES DE REPASO COLEGIO DE BACHILLERATO CARIMANGA TRABAJO REALIZADO POR: Carmen Lucía Alverca
  2. 1.1. Proporcione cuatro ejemplos de sistemas de base de datos Distintos a los enumerados de la sección 1.1. • Cuerpo de bomberos • Registro de docentes en un centro educativo • Reserva de un hotel • Utilización telefónica móvil
  3. 1.2. Explique cada uno de los siguientes términos: a) Datos: Los datos se caracterizan por no contener ninguna información. Un dato puede significar un número, una letra, un signo ortográfico o cualquier símbolo que represente una cantidad, una medida, una palabra o una descripción. b) Base de datos: Es una colección compartida de datos Lógicamente relacionados, junto con una descripción de estos Tantos, que están diseñados para satisfacer de información de Una organización. c) Sistema de Gestión de la Base de Datos: Es un Sistema Software que permite a los usuarios definir, crear, Mantener y controlar el acceso a la base de datos.
  4. d) Programa de aplicación de base de datos: Es un Programa informático que interactúa con la base de datos Emitiendo las apropiadas solicitudes dirigidas a SGBD. e) Independencia de los datos: La independencia de datos se puede definir como la capacidad para modificar el esquema en un nivel del sistema sin tener que modificar el esquema del nivel inmediato superior. Se pueden definir dos tipos de independencia de datos: • La independencia lógica es la capacidad de modificar el esquema conceptual sin tener que alterar los esquemas externos ni los programas de aplicación. • La independencia física es la capacidad de modificar el esquema interno sin tener que alterar el esquema conceptual (o los externos).
  5. f) Seguridad: Los procedimientos sencillos que a la larga se convierten en grandes inconvenientes que afecta en lo concerniente a la seguridad, todo tiene que quedar de acuerdo con lo planeado sin ninguna omisión por más mínima que sea, así como en la instalación del diseño y desarrollo, cualquier punto que se deje sin preocupación debida que no puede afectar en nada puede ser la entrada para los atacantes. g) Integridad: La integridad de los datos almacenados puede perderse de muchas maneras diferentes. Pueden añadirse datos no válidos a la base de datos, tales como un pedido que especifica un producto no existente. h) Vistas: Con esta funcionalidad, los SGBD es una herramien- ta extremadamente potente y útil.
  6. 1.3. Describa el enfoque de tratamiento de los datos adoptado en los antiguos sistemas basados en archivos. Indique las ventajas de este enfoque. • Fueron desarrollados para dar respuesta que las empresas tenían de acceder de forma mas eficiente a los datos. • Adopta un enfoque descentralizado, en el que cada departamento, con la ayuda de personal personalizado en procedimiento de datos, • Almacenaba y controlaba sus propios datos. • Cada departamento accede a sus propios archivos utilizando un programa de aplicación escritos especialmente para ellos. • Cada conjunto de programas de aplicación departamentales se encargan de gestionar la introducción de datos, el mantenimiento de los archivos y la generación de un conjunto fijo de informes especiales. • Tiene mayor importancia, la estructura física y el almacenamiento de los archivos y registros de datos están definidos por el código de aplicación.
  7. DESVENTAJAS:  Separación e aislamiento de datos  Duplicación de los datos  Dependencias entre los datos  Formatos de archivos incompatibles  Consultas fijas/ proliferación de programas de aplicación
  8. 1.4. Describa las principales características del enfoque de base de datos y compárelas con la técnica basada en archivos. En enfoque de base de datos podemos modificar la definición interna de un objeto en cambio en la técnica basada en archivos resulta difícil realizar cambios a una estructura existente. En el enfoque de base de datos los programas que se modifican se almacena dicha estructura en la propia base de datos en cambio en la técnica basada en archivos los programas modificados se almacenan en una nueva estructura del archivo. En el enfoque de base de datos la descripción de los datos se conoce con el nombre de catálogo del sistema en cambio en la técnica basada en archivos a los sistemas basados en archivos se los denomina dependencia entre los programas y los datos.
  9. 1.5. Describa los 5 componentes del entorno SGBD y explique como se relacionan entre sí. Hardware: puede ir desde una única computadora personal hasta un único mainframe o una red de computadoras. Software: comprende en el propio Software SGBD en los programas de aplicación, junto con el sistema operativo, que influye el Software de red si el SGBD Se está utilizando en una red. Datos: actúan como una especie de puente entre los componentes ligados a la máquina y los componentes ligados al operador humano.
  10. Procedimientos: Los usuarios del sistema y el personal que gestiona la base de datos requieren una serie de procedimientos documentados que les permitan como saber utilizar o ejecutar el sistema. Personas: Se relacionan con el sistema.
  11. 1.6. Explique el papel de cada una de las siguientes personas en un entorno de base de datos: a) Administrador de los datos: Es responsable de gestionar los recursos de datos: planificación, desarrollo y mantenimiento de políticas y estándares. b) Administrador de la base de datos: Es responsable de la implementación y diseño físico de la base de datos. c) Diseñador lógico de la base de datos: Identifica, relaciones y modelo de datos.
  12. d) Diseñador físico de la base de datos: Materializa el diseño lógico mediante estructuras y métodos de Almacenamiento, seguidores, etc. e) Desarrollador de aplicaciones: Implementan los programas de aplicación que propor- cionan facilidad requerida. Extraer, insertar, actualizar y borrar datos con algunas operaciones solicitadas.} f) Usuarios finales: Son las unidades de la base de datos. Pueden ser: * Usuarios inexpertos * Usuarios avanzados
  13. 1.7. Explique las ventajas y desventajas de los SGBD. VENTAJAS:  Control de redundancia de los datos: Los sistemas tradicionales basados en archivos desperdician espacio al almacenar la misma información en más de un archivo.  Coherencia de los datos: Si un elemento de datos solo se almacenan una vez en la base de datos, las actualizaciones, de su valor solo tienen que llevarse a cabo una vez y el nuevo valor estará disponible de forma inmediata para todos los usuarios.  Más información a partir de la misma cantidad de datos: Al integrar los datos operacionales, la información puede deducir información adicional a partir de conjunto de datos existente.
  14.  Compartición de los datos: Normalmente, los archivos son propiedad de las personas o departamentos que los usan. Por otro lado, la base de datos pertenece a toda la organización y puede ser compartida por todos los usuarios autorizados.  Mayor integridad en los datos: Hace referencia a la validez y coherencia de los datos almacenados.  Mayor seguridad: Es la protección de los datos frente a su uso por personas no autorizadas.  Imposición de estándares: La imposición permite al DBA definir e imponer los estándares necesarios.
  15.  Economía de escala: Al cambiar todos los datos operacionales de una organización en una única base de datos y crear un conjunto de aplicaciones que funcionan con esta fuente centralizada de datos, pueden reducirse enormemente los costes.  Equilibrio entre los requisitos conflictivos: Cada usuario de departamento tiene necesidades que pueden entrar en conflicto con las de otros usuarios.  Mejor accesibilidad de los datos y mayor capacidad de respuesta: Los datos que atraviesan las fronteras son accesibles de modo directo por usuarios finales.
  16.  Mayor productividad: Proporciona muchas de las funciones estándar que el programador tendría normalmente que incluir dentro de su aplicación basada en archivos a un nivel básico.  Mantenimiento simplificado gracias a la independencia de los datos: En los sistemas basados en archivos, las descripciones de los datos y la lógica para acceder a los datos están integradas en cada programa de aplicación, haciendo que los programas sean dependientes de los datos.  Mayor nivel de concurrencia: En algunos sistemas basados en archivos, si se permite a dos o mas usuarios acceder al mismo archivo simultáneamente, es posible que los accesos se interfieran entre sí, provocando una pérdida de información o incluso de la integridad de los datos.
  17.  Servicios mejorados de copia de seguridad y recuperación: Muchos sistemas basados en archivos asignan al usuario la responsabilidad de proporcionar medidas para proteger los datos frente a fallos del sistema informático o de los programadores de aplicación.  Servicios mejorados de copia de seguridad y recuperación: Muchos sistemas basados en archivos asignan al usuario la responsabilidad de proporcionar medidas para proteger los datos frente a fallos del sistema informático o de los programadores de aplicación.
  18. DESVENTAJAS:  Complejidad: Los desarrolladores y diseñadores de base de datos, los administradores de datos y de base de datos y los usuarios finales deben ser capaces de comprender esta funcionalidad para poder aprovecharla al máximo.  Tamaño: La complejidad y el amplio rango de funcionalidades hacen que el SGBD sea un Software de gran tamaño, que ocupa muchos Mb de espacio de disco y requiere una cantidad de memoria importante para poder ejecutarse de manera eficiente.  Coste del SGBD: El coste de los SGBD varía significativamente, dependiendo del entorno y de la funcionalidad proporcionada.
  19.  Coste de Hardware adicional: Los requisitos de almacenamiento en disco para el SGBD y la base de datos pueden imponer la compra de espacio de almacenamiento adicional.  Costes de conversión: En algunas situaciones, el coste del SGBD y del Hardware adicional puede ser insignificante si lo comparamos con el coste de convertir las aplicaciones existentes para que se ejecuten sobre el nuevo SGBD y sobre la nueva plataforma Hardware.  Prestaciones: Normalmente, los sistemas basados en archivos se escriben para una aplicación específica, como por ejemplo una aplicación de facturación.  Mayor impacto de los fallos: La centralización de los recursos implementan la vulnerabilidad del sistema. Puesto que todos los usuarios y aplicaciones dependen de la disponibilidad del SGBD.
Publicidad